Locked Down
finally, their sirens cease. wailing echoes fade into foreign silence at first... everything is still until the first cellar door tentatively cracks open very slowly those that are not dead emerge eyes shielded from sunlight squinting at nature’s misshapen forms lungs greedily gulp clean air everything is changed yet we are the same
